En el mundo digital actual, donde las interacciones en dispositivos móviles y la velocidad de carga son más cruciales que nunca, las Progressive Web Apps (PWA) han emergido como una solución robusta y innovadora para negocios y desarrolladores por igual. Estas aplicaciones ofrecen una experiencia que une lo mejor de las aplicaciones nativas con las ventajas de la web, transformando la manera en la que los usuarios interactúan con los contenidos y servicios en línea. Pero, ¿qué es PWA realmente? En esencia, una Progressive Web App es una aplicación que funciona sin problemas en diferentes dispositivos y plataformas gracias a la tecnología web, lo que permite a las empresas alcanzar un público más amplio al tiempo que mejoran la experiencia de usuario.
Las PWAs están diseñadas para ser veloces, confiables y atractivas, y son capaces de proporcionar funcionalidades similares a las de las aplicaciones nativas, tales como el acceso a notificaciones push, trabajos en modo offline y una interfaz de usuario amigable. La revolución de las Progressive Web Apps no solo ha mejorado la interacción entre usuarios y marcas, sino que también ha demostrado ser una solución eficaz para incrementar el engagement y, por ende, las conversiones. En este artículo, exploraremos el fascinante mundo de las PWA, desde sus características y ventajas, hasta las tecnologías que facilitaron su desarrollo, sus requisitos, ejemplos notables, los beneficios que pueden aportar a tu negocio y algunas conclusiones finales sobre su implementación.
- ¿Qué son las Progressive Web Apps (PWA)?
- Características y ventajas de las PWA
- Tecnologías utilizadas en el desarrollo de PWA
- Requisitos para el desarrollo de PWA
- Ejemplos exitosos de Progressive Web Apps
- Beneficios de implementar una PWA para tu negocio
- Consideraciones finales sobre las Progressive Web Apps
- Conclusión
¿Qué son las Progressive Web Apps (PWA)?
Las Progressive Web Apps son aplicaciones que aprovechan las capacidades que ofrecen los navegadores modernos para brindar experiencias similares a las de las aplicaciones nativas. Un aspecto fundamental que define a las PWAs es su capacidad de “progresar”: esto significa que pueden mejorar en funcionalidad y rendimiento a medida que los navegadores y dispositivos evolucionan. En términos simples, una PWA comienza como un sitio web y, con el tiempo, se convierte en una aplicación avanzada aprovechando características como el almacenamiento en caché, servicios de fondo y más.
Una de las características que destaca en el uso de una PWA es el hecho de que se puede instalar en la pantalla de inicio del usuario desde el navegador, sin necesidad de pasar por una tienda de aplicaciones. Esto presenta un alivio tanto para desarrolladores como para usuarios, ya que elimina las complicaciones de las descargas y las actualizaciones constantes que se necesitan cuando se utiliza una aplicación nativa. Además, las Progressive Web Apps pueden funcionar offline o en redes de baja calidad, lo cual las convierte en una opción sumamente valiosa para mercados emergentes y usuarios con conectividad limitada.
Características y ventajas de las PWA
Interactividad y alta velocidad
Las Progressive Web Apps están diseñadas para cargar rápidamente, independientemente de la calidad del entorno de red. Esta velocidad es fundamental, especialmente cuando cada segundo de retraso puede resultar en una pérdida masiva de usuarios potenciales. Gracias a su naturaleza optimizada, las PWA permiten a los usuarios interactuar con contenidos casi instantáneamente, lo que mejora drásticamente la tasa de retención. Los desarrolladores pueden implementar técnicas como el almacenamiento en caché de recursos y la precarga de contenidos para […]
Experiencia confiable
Otro aspecto que resalta a las Progressive Web Apps es su capacidad de funcionar de manera confiable incluso en entornos de red inestables o sin conexión. Estas aplicaciones utilizan service workers para gestionar el almacenaje en caché y permitir el acceso a contenidos almacenados previamente, asegurando que los usuarios puedan seguir interactuando con la aplicación sin problemas. Este nivel de confiabilidad es un gran punto a favor para las empresas que buscan mantener el interés del usuario y facilitar un acceso sencillo a la información en cualquier circunstancia.
Instalación y acceso fáciles
A diferencia de las aplicaciones nativas que requieren descarga e instalación desde tiendas específicas de aplicaciones, las PWA se pueden instalar directamente desde el navegador web. Este proceso es tan sencillo como visitar una página web y elegir “Agregar a pantalla de inicio”. Esta opción elimina la barrera de entrada y permite que más usuarios tengan acceso a la aplicación cómodamente. A su vez, este acceso sencillo acelera el ciclo de vida de la PWA, permitiendo que las empresas recojan datos y feedback en tiempo real desde sus usuarios.
Actualizaciones automáticas
Un gran beneficio de las Progressive Web Apps es que se actualizan automáticamente. No es necesario que los usuarios descarguen nuevas versiones cada vez que hay un cambio o mejora en la aplicación. Este aspecto es particularmente atractivo para los negocios, ya que asegura que todos los usuarios estén siempre utilizando la versión más reciente y optimizada de la aplicación, lo cual puede reducir la fragmentación y los conflictos que ocurren en entornos de aplicaciones tradicionales.
Interfaz amigable y responsive
Las PWA están diseñadas para ser responsivas, lo que significa que su diseño se adaptará a diferentes tamaños de pantalla y resoluciones, brindando una experiencia usuario consistente, ya sea en móviles, tabletas o computadoras de escritorio. Esta flexibilidad es clave en un mundo donde los usuarios acceden a la web desde una variedad de dispositivos. Al implementar una Progressive Web App, las empresas pueden asegurarse de que el contenido sea accesible y visualmente atractivo para su audiencia sin importar el dispositivo que estén utilizando.
Tecnologías utilizadas en el desarrollo de PWA
HTML, CSS y JavaScript
El corazón de todas las Progressive Web Apps radica en HTML, CSS y JavaScript. Estas tecnologías están diseñadas para funcionar sin problemas juntos, permitiendo a los desarrolladores construir interfaces de usuario atractivas y funcionales. HTML se encarga de la estructura básica del contenido, CSS se ocupa del diseño y la presentación, mientras que JavaScript aporta la interactividad. Un conjunto robusto de herramientas y bibliotecas, como React, Angular y Vue.js, también se utilizan frecuentemente para incrementar la funcionalidad de las PWA.
Service Workers
Los service workers son scripts que el navegador ejecuta en segundo plano, independientemente de la página web abierta. Este componente esencial es una parte clave de la arquitectura de las Progressive Web Apps ya que permite la gestión del caché y la implementación de push notifications. Los desarrolladores pueden programar los service workers para interceptar las solicitudes de red y responder con datos almacenados en caché, proporcionando así una experiencia offline excepcional. Esta característica transforma fundamentalmente la manera en que los usuarios interactúan con el contenido y mejora significativamente la usabilidad de la aplicación.
Web App Manifests
El manifiesto de la web es un archivo JSON que proporciona información esencial sobre la Progressive Web App, como el nombre, íconos, temas de color y opciones de visualización. Este manifiesto permite que el navegador maneje la instalación de la PWA en la pantalla de inicio del dispositivo móvil, así como establecer una experiencia más acorde a las expectativas de los usuarios. Al proporcionar un manifiesto bien estructurado, los desarrolladores pueden garantizar que su PWA brinde una primera impresión positiva y fiel de marca a los usuarios.
HTTPS
Para asegurar una conexión segura y fiable, las Progressive Web Apps requieren de un entorno seguro mediante HTTPS. Este protocolo no solo protege los datos transmitidos entre la aplicación y el servidor, sino que también es esencial para la activación de características como el uso de service workers. La implementación de HTTPS es un paso crucial y debe ser tomado en serie al desarrollar una PWA, ya que sin este elemento básico, la aplicación no podrá aprovechar todas las funcionalidades que ofrece esta novedosa tecnología.
Requisitos para el desarrollo de PWA
Un sitio web optimizado
El primer paso esencial para desarrollar una Progressive Web App es asegurarse de que el sitio web base esté optimizado para dispositivos móviles. Esto incluye la implementación de un diseño responsive, asegurando que los tiempos de carga sean mínimos y que el contenido esté organizado de manera que los usuarios puedan navegar y acceder a la información fácilmente. Sin estas características previas, la conversión de un sitio web en una PWA simplemente no funcionará, y se perderán las oportunidades de aprovechar las ventajas de esta poderosa tecnología.
Conocimiento técnico adecuado
Desarrollar una Progressive Web App requiere un conjunto específico de habilidades técnicas. Los desarrolladores deben tener un conocimiento sólido de HTML, CSS y JavaScript, además de estar familiarizados con las mejores prácticas para el desarrollo de PWA y cómo funcionan los service workers y el manejo del almacenamiento en caché. Sin una comprensión adecuada de estas herramientas y protocolos, se hace difícil crear una experiencia de usuario efectiva y aprovechar todo el potencial de las Progressive Web Apps.
Implementación de pruebas
Como en cualquier proyecto de desarrollo de software, las pruebas son una parte integral del proceso. Las Progressive Web Apps requieren un enfoque exhaustivo de pruebas para asegurar que funcionen sin problemas en diferentes navegadores y dispositivos. Obligar a los desarrolladores a realizar pruebas de rendimiento y usabilidad es fundamental para garantizar que se ofrezca una experiencia fluida a los usuarios. Además, utilizar herramientas de monitoreo y análisis permite obtener datos sobre la utilización de la aplicación, permitiendo ajustes y mejoras continuas.
Ejemplos exitosos de Progressive Web Apps
Petlove
Un ejemplo paradigmático del éxito de las Progressive Web Apps es Petlove, una famosa tienda de productos para mascotas en Brasil. Al implementar una PWA, la empresa logró proporcionar a sus usuarios una experiencia de compra fluida y rápida, incrementando así sus tasas de conversión. Con la capacidad de acceder a la tienda online desde cualquier dispositivo, incluso en situaciones de conexión deficiente, Petlove pudo evitar pérdidas potenciales de clientes. Las estadísticas posteriores al lanzamiento de su PWA mostraron un incremento notable en el engagement de usuarios, y su éxito ha impulsado a muchas otras empresas en el sector a considerar la implementación de una estrategia similar.
Starbucks
Starbucks también ha dado un ejemplo notable de cómo una Progressive Web App puede revolucionar la experiencia del cliente. La PWA de Starbucks permite a los usuarios explorar el menú, realizar pedidos y pagar directamente desde el navegador, eliminando la necesitar de descargar la aplicación nativa. Esto ha llevado no solo a una mayor satisfacción del cliente, sino que también ha resultado en un aumento significativo en las ventas y en la fidelización de los clientes. La combinación de la facilidad de uso y la capacidad de compra en un solo lugar ha revolucionado la forma en que los clientes interactúan con la marca.
Pinterest es otro ejemplo renombrado que ha experimentado éxitos notables tras la implementación de su PWA. Antes de desarrollar su versión PWA, Pinterest enfrentaba problemas de retención de usuarios, sobre todo en condiciones de red débil. Desde la implementación de la Progressive Web App, la plataforma ha observado un aumento en la tasa de retorno de los usuarios así como en el tiempo que estos pasan en la aplicación. Esta mejora está respaldada por el acceso rápido a contenido visual y la posibilidad de poder navegar sin interrupciones, facilitando que los usuarios se sumergieran en la experiencia de descubrimiento de Pinterest.
Beneficios de implementar una PWA para tu negocio
Aumento de la tasa de conversión
Una de las ventajas más significativas que las Progressive Web Apps pueden proporcionar a las empresas es el aumento de la tasa de conversión. Al brindar una experiencia de usuario mucho más fluida, rápida y confiable, los clientes son más propensos a completar compras o interacciones. Cuando se reduce la fricción en el camino del usuario, esto lleva a que más personas terminen completando sus transacciones. Las estadísticas han demostrado consistentemente que las PWA pueden ayudar a las empresas a mejorar su tasa de conversión en un porcentaje considerable, lo que representa un beneficio directo para el negocio.
Mejor experiencia de usuario
Implementar una Progressive Web App no solo se traduce en mejores métricas de negocio, sino que también crea un entorno más amigable para el usuario. Una buena experiencia de usuario se traduce en comodidad y satisfacción, lo que alimenta la fidelidad del cliente y promueve la recomendación. Las PWA garantizan que los usuarios puedan acceder al contenido fácilmente y de forma intuitiva, lo que generará una atmósfera positiva en torno a la marca y su oferta de productos o servicios.
Acceso a datos valiosos
Las Progressive Web Apps permiten a las empresas recopilar una gran cantidad de datos sobre el comportamiento de los usuarios. Gracias a herramientas de análisis integradas, los desarrolladores pueden obtener información valiosa sobre cómo los usuarios interactúan con la aplicación, las páginas que visitan, los tiempos de permanencia y las tasas de caída. Este tipo de información es invaluable para las empresas que buscan mejorar su oferta y hacer ajustes para optimizar la conversión. Desde realizar pruebas A/B hasta hacer cambios en función de la retroalimentación de usuarios, las PWA ofrecen la capacidad de evolucionar y adaptarse en tiempo real.
Versatilidad y accesibilidad
Las Progressive Web Apps son por definición versátiles. Su capacidad de utilizarse en variados sistemas operativos y dispositivos significa que las empresas pueden llegar a una audiencia mayor sin tener que desarrollar aplicaciones separadas para diferentes plataformas. Además, una PWA es accesible desde cualquier navegador y no requiere descargas, lo que la hace extremadamente conveniente para los usuarios. Esta accesibilidad es fundamental en un mundo en el que cada vez más usuarios eligen navegar desde sus teléfonos móviles.
Consideraciones finales sobre las Progressive Web Apps
Las Progressive Web Apps ofrecen un futuro brillante tanto para desarrolladores como para empresas que buscan mejorar sus interacciones con los usuarios y optimizar sus servicios digitales. Su potencial para atraer usuarios, fomentar la lealtad y generar conversiones es indiscutible, motivo por el cual cada vez más empresas están eligiendo esta forma de tecnología. Es importante recordar que, si bien desarrollar una PWA puede parecer desafiante, las herramientas y conocimientos futuros están disponibles para hacer el proceso mucho más manejable.
La implementación de una Progressive Web App debe ser vista como una inversión en el futuro digital de la empresa. Con un entorno digital en constante cambio, aquellas empresas que decidan adoptar y fomentar el uso de PWA verán los beneficios no solo en términos de métricas de negocio, sino también en la satisfacción y fidelidad de sus clientes. Es el momento de unirse a la revolución que las Progressive Web Apps están trayendo al mundo digital; la cuestión ya no es si hacer la transición, sino cuándo hacerlo.
Conclusión
Las Progressive Web Apps no son simplemente una tendencia pasajera en el mundo de la tecnología; representan un avance significativo en cómo interactuamos con el contenido digital. Su combinación de velocidad, accesibilidad y características optimizadas las convierte en una opción atractiva para cualquier empresa que busque mejorar su presencia en línea. A medida que cada vez más usuarios esperan y exigen experiencias digitales rápidas y sofisticadas, la oportunidad para las empresas de implementar una PWA nunca ha sido mayor. En última instancia, este tipo de tecnología tiene el potencial de revolucionar la forma en que las marcas se comunican y se conectan con sus usuarios, lo que puede traducirse en un mayor éxito comercial a largo plazo.
Si quieres conocer otros artículos parecidos a PWA: Todo sobre las Progressive Web Apps y su desarrollo puedes visitar la categoría Conceptos web.
